problems with upgrading to i5-4690k, no post

THANK YOU EVERYONE! I solved it! It works for me! I will describe it in summary:
(I had a H81M-E which  didn't accept a i7 4790)

 

0. Your ME version in bios is probable the old 9.0.2.13455. Check it in BIOS. That is the problem. In this case, follow the steps below:

1. INSTALL WIN7 OR WIN10. (with any older haswell cpu)

 

IF YOU HAVE WINDOWS 7 INSTALLED:
2.1. Download the files from asus.com.
2.1.1. First select your motherboard. Choose Support > Driver and Tools > Windows 7 64-bit and search and download the "Management Engine Interface V9.0.0.1287". (If you can't find it use "See All Downloads".)
2.1.2. Second search and download the BIOS Update "Version 2.00.02". Its name is "BIOS updater for New 4th Gen Intel Core Processors". (If you can't find it use "See All Downloads".)
2.1.3. Third download the latest BIOS update (BIOS 3602 in case of H81M-E).
2.2. Install "Management Engine Interface V9.0.0.1287" in windows 7.
2.3. Reboot.
2.4. Run "BIOS updater for New 4th Gen Intel Core Processors" and browse the the latest BIOS update.
2.5. Reboot. (You can check in BIOS that ME version is now 9.0.30.1482)
2.6. Replace the CPU with new one. It will work! :)

 

IF YOU HAVE WINDOWS 10 INSTALLED:
3.1. Download the files from asus.com.
3.1.1. First select your motherboard. Choose Support > Driver and Tools > Windows 10 64-bit and search and download the "Management Engine Interface V9.5.15.1730". (If you can't find it use "See All Downloads".)
3.1.2. Second search and download the BIOS Update "Version 2.00.02". Its name is "BIOS updater for New 4th Gen Intel Core Processors". (If you can't find it use "See All Downloads".)
3.1.3. Third download the latest BIOS update (BIOS 3602 in case of H81M-E).
3.2. Install "Management Engine Interface V9.0.0.1287" in windows 10. Installer complained at the end, but ignore it.
3.3. Reboot.
3.4. Run "BIOS updater for New 4th Gen Intel Core Processors" and browse the the latest BIOS update.
3.5. Reboot. (You can check in BIOS that ME version is now 9.0.30.1482)
3.6. Replace the CPU with new one. It will work! :)
